## Deploying the Gatewick Proctor Queue

Deploys are pretty painless: push to main, wait for the pipeline, then watch the queue drain dashboard for five minutes. If candidates pile up mid-exam, roll back first and ask questions later — the queue replays safely. Everything the workers care about lives in one config block, shown here for reference.

settings of bafof-yagef:
JOROX_PIN=8740
JOROX_TENANT=pelox
JOROX_METRICS_HOST=metrics.jorox.qorvelworks.internal
JOROX_SEAL=seal_c78f63c1
JOROX_STANDBY_TEAM=norax

Dispatch desk — master copies for Quarrow Print Works need to go out today. These are the originals for the Helmsby catalogue run; no duplicates exist, so they travel in the rigid folder, flat, nothing stacked on top. Office manager has signed the release form and it's clipped to the folder. Print shop needs them before 15:00 or the press slot is lost. Courier should ask for the floor supervisor by role, not wait at the counter. Hand-over instruction for the courier:

dispatch memo: the lamwyn fenwyn courier leaves the wenir ledger at gate 7175 under passcode 822969

Quick note for the board ahead of Q4 planning: we're penciling in 34 new hires for Vantrell Systems next year, weighted toward the Oakmere engineering hub. Marta Kellen's team gets priority, then customer ops. Nothing wild — we're staying lean until the Brightline launch proves out. Full breakdown at the January session. The sensitive piece on expansion plans follows below.

board note of kageg-bahof: The renewal with Holwynax Holdings closes at $2 million a year, 5 percent below the last contract. Project Ulaath slips by two quarters because of the supplier delay.

HANDOVER — ProfileVault shard migration

Status: shards 1–6 live, 7–9 pending backfill. Plugin authors: lookup API unchanged; write hooks now require shard hints, docs updated. Do not assume monotonic user IDs anymore. Backfill job runs nightly; expect lag spikes 02:00–04:00. Dual-write toggle stays on until shard 9 verifies. Open item: hash-ring rebalance script needs review before 7 goes live. Questions on the migration plan go to the new owner below.

named custodian: Brivan Eliath Quenox Frador